Abstract

317,560. Jackson, L. Mellersh-, (Siemens & Halske Akt.-Ges.). May 31, 1928. Attenuating equalizers and similar impedance networks; amplifying systems. - An electric instrument for diagnosing or correcting defective hearing includes a device which decreases the intensity of the audible sounds from a chosen limit frequency in a progressively increasing measure towards low frequencies. The device may comprise a sound-receiving instrument m, which is preferably more sensitive to sounds of higher audible frequency connected to an aperiodic filter S, the circuit of which is shown in Fig. 2. The varying potentials from the filter S are led into an amplifying device v which feeds a telephone t preferably made especially sensitive to the sounds of higher audible frequency and well damped. The filter may contain inductances as well as resistances and capacities, and may be combined with the amplifier.
